6.3. DB PV MODULES DATABASE MANAGEMENT
The instrument allows defining and saving up to approx. 63.000 modules. The
parameters related to 1 module and the @STC conditions that can be set are shown in
Table 1 below:

CAUTION
The parameters "Perf.@Yr1" and "Perf.@Yr2" represent the module
performance percentages declared in the manufacturer's data sheet
The "Years@Perf.1" and "Years@Perf.2" parameters represent the years
of operation of the module to which the manufacturer has assigned the
performance associated with the "Perf.@Yr1" and "Perf.@Yr2” parameters
On the basis of these values, the instrument automatically calculates the
Years/Performance curve (see Fig. 23) from which to derive the
performance loss control value % used to calculate the I-V curve (see §
6.4.4)
